Forgotten pot leads to fire at Ward Warehouse eatery

Grease from a pot left unattended on a stove started a kitchen fire early this morning in a Ward Warehouse takeout restaurant causing $2,000 worth of damage.

Security officials at the Kakaako shopping contacted the fire department at 1:52 a.m. The fire at Korean Barbeque Express kiosk at the ewa end of the shopping center was brought under control at 2:03 a.m.

Three other restaurants in the kiosk were not affected.

No injuries were reported.
